"Houston, we have a problem."

When Rich got the car as he was putting on the pulley he emailed me some pictures of supercharger oil on the ribs of the engine beneath the snout. As I was going to take my daughter for a ride on Thanksgiving day I remembered to take a look. More puddles. Dang! Yesterday I dried everything off, and this afternoon took it for a little spin and it sure feels like there is oil coming from the area of the pulley down the snout. I'm not sure I did enough drive time to really confirm so now it will probably wait a while.

This was the kind of thing I had concerns about on a low miles car that has sat for 5+ years. I've got some plans working but will likely pick up a take off one and send this one to rebuild (PSE Superchargers) so I have a spare.

I'm a competent wrencher so will probably do the swap myself. From some descriptions it's easiest with two people and have a volunteer helper although I think I can enlist my mechanic friend for a bottle of Black Velvet.

He didn't remove the snout for the pulley upgrade? If you want something done right, do it yourself...

The S/C has to be removed to change the pulley on the stock Ford snout. There is not enough room. The Kenne Bell allows it to be changed without removing the S/C but you have to do the change once. But the bearing/seal on the pulley shaft is not disturbed during this process. The seal between the snout and the S/C body seems to be OK.
